<?php function printTruncated($maxLength, $html, $isUtf8=true) { $printedLength = 0; $position = 0; $tags = array(); // For UTF-8, we need to count multibyte sequences as one character. $re = $isUtf8 ? '{</?([a-z]+)[^>]*>|&#?[a-zA-Z0-9]+;|[\x80-\xFF][\x80-\xBF]*}' : '{</?([a-z]+)[^>]*>|&#?[a-zA-Z0-9]+;}'; while ($printedLength < $maxLength && preg_match($re, $html, $match, PREG_OFFSET_CAPTURE, $position)) { list($tag, $tagPosition) = $match[0]; // Print text leading up to the tag. $str = substr($html, $position, $tagPosition - $position); if ($printedLength + strlen($str) > $maxLength) { print(substr($str, 0, $maxLength - $printedLength)); $printedLength = $maxLength; break; } print($str); $printedLength += strlen($str); if ($printedLength >= $maxLength) break; if ($tag[0] == '&' || ord($tag) >= 0x80) { // Pass the entity or UTF-8 multibyte sequence through unchanged. print($tag); $printedLength++; } else { // Handle the tag. $tagName = $match[1][0]; if ($tag[1] == '/') { // This is a closing tag. $openingTag = array_pop($tags); assert($openingTag == $tagName); // check that tags are properly nested. print($tag); } else if ($tag[strlen($tag) - 2] == '/') { // Self-closing tag. print($tag); } else { // Opening tag. print($tag); $tags[] = $tagName; } } // Continue after the tag. $position = $tagPosition + strlen($tag); } // Print any remaining text. if ($printedLength < $maxLength && $position < strlen($html)) { print(substr($html, $position, $maxLength - $printedLength)); } // Close any open tags. while (!empty($tags)) { printf('</%s>', array_pop($tags)); } } printTruncated(10, '<b>&lt;Hello&gt;</b> <img src="world.png" alt="" /> world!'); print("\n"); printTruncated(10, '<table><tr><td>Heck, </td><td>throw</td></tr><tr><td>in a</td><td>table</td></tr></table>'); print("\n"); printTruncated(10, "<em><b>Hello</b>&#20;w\xC3\xB8rld!</em>"); print("\n");
